Similarity solution of the Boussinesq equation
Similarity transforms of the Boussinesq equation in a semi-in®nite medium are available when the boundary conditions are a power of time. The Boussinesq equation is reduced from a partial dierential equation to a boundary-value problem. Chen et al. متن کاملExistence and blow-up of solution of Cauchy problem for the sixth order damped Boussinesq equation
In this paper, we consider the existence and uniqueness of the global solution for the sixth-order damped Boussinesq equation. Moreover, the finite-time blow-up of the solution for the equation is investigated by the concavity method.
متن کاملThe Boussinesq equation revisited
The continuous spectrum and soliton solutions for the Boussinesq equation are investigated using the ∂̄-dressing method. Solitons demonstrate quite extraordinary behavior; they may decay or form a singularity in a finite time. متن کاملNUMERICAL SOLUTION OF BOUSSINESQ EQUATION USING MODIFIED ADOMIAN DECOMPOSITION AND HOMOTOPY ANALYSIS METHODS
In this paper, a Boussinesq equation is solved by using the Adomian's decomposition method, modified Adomian's decomposition method and homotopy analysis method. The approximate solution of this equation is calculated in the form of series which its components are computed by applying a recursive relation.
